Durability is a critical concern for outdoor products, and the Camco Rhino waste tank does not disappoint. Measuring 20 ½″ (L) x 13″ (W) x 40″ (H) and weighing 34.5 lb, it is made from tough, UV-stabilized blow-molded HDPE. This means that it can withstand the rigors of outdoor use without leaking or succumbing to sun damage. Understanding Gray Water

Gray water refers to wastewater generated from activities like showering, washing dishes, or doing laundry. It doesn’t include sewage, which makes it easier to manage and recycle. Knowing this helped me appreciate the importance of having a portable tank to store gray water until I could properly dispose of it.

Capacity Considerations

One of the first things I considered was the capacity of the tank. I needed to assess my typical water usage and determine how much gray water I would generate during my trips. Tanks come in various sizes, typically ranging from 5 to 20 gallons. I found that a larger capacity tank would allow for fewer trips to dispose of the waste, making my experience more convenient.

Material and Durability

The material of the tank is another critical factor. I wanted something robust and resistant to corrosion and UV damage. Most gray water tanks are made from durable plastics, which can withstand the elements. I researched the pros and cons of different materials, ensuring that the tank I choose would last through multiple seasons of use.

Portability Features

Since I often moved my tank from one location to another, portability was essential. I looked for features like sturdy handles and wheels. A tank that is easy to maneuver made my life significantly easier, especially when it was full. I also considered the weight of the tank when empty and full, ensuring I could handle it comfortably.

Ease of Use and Maintenance

I wanted a tank that was user-friendly. Features like a wide opening for easy filling and emptying were high on my list. Additionally, I considered how easy it would be to clean. A tank that could be easily rinsed out and maintained would save me time and effort in the long run.

Disposal Options

Understanding how to dispose of gray water was also crucial. Some tanks come with options for connecting to standard sewer systems, while others may require a different method. I took the time to research local regulations regarding gray water disposal to ensure I remained compliant. This knowledge helped me choose a tank that matched my disposal needs.
